SEEDS coordinates Preschool Early Intervention services, performs multi-disciplinary evaluations, and contracts with provider agencies for ongoing Preschool Early Intervention services. Children are served in the least restrictive environment possible to meet their educational and developmental needs. Locations can include the child's home, a Head Start center, a community day care or nursery school, or a center-based Preschool Early Intervention program. Services include special instruction, occupational therapy, speech therapy, physical therapy, and nursing or any combination of these.

POSITION SUMMARY: Provide direct specialized instruction to preschool children with special needs in community and home based settings.

D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Provide special instruction as recommended in each child's Individual Education Plan (IEP) within the context of the natural environment
  • Complete required documentation including daily Service Verification Notes, Biannual Progress Monitoring, and other necessary reports
  • Maintain a caseload of 25-50 children based on the duration and frequency of services as indicated on each IEP (caseload prorated if working less than 40 hours per week)
  • Provide ongoing assessment of eligibility including providing re-evaluation when necessary and plan appropriately for discharge of children
  • Participate in IEP meetings, providing service recommendations, present levels of performance, and goals/outcomes
  • Participate in team/staff meetings designed to support the overall function of the program
  • Participate in professional development opportunities within and outside of Elwyn that are appropriate to the field of special education
  • Participate in supervision, feedback, mentoring, and self-reflection to support therapeutic excellence
  • Complete other duties as assigned

EDUCATION/EXPERIENCE/SKILLS REQUIREMENTS:

  • Bachelor's Degree in Early Childhood/Special Education is required
  • Master's Degree in Early Childhood/Special Education is preferred
  • PA School Certification in Early Childhood/Special Education is required
  • Minimum of one (1) year of experience working with young children with special needs is preferred
  • Demonstrated ability to work effectively as part of a team
  • Must be able to perform CPR using agency-trained protocols
  • Must possess excellent customer interaction, collaboration, presentation, and written and verbal communication skills
  • Demonstrated intermediate experience with Microsoft Office applications, including Word, Excel, Outlook, and PowerPoint; Access, Publisher and report-writer experience preferred
  • Ability and means to travel on a flexible schedule as needed; if driving personal vehicle must have current, valid driver's license in state of residence, three (3) years driving experience, and acceptable driving record in addition to proof of liability and property damage insurance on vehicle used is required
